What Is Flexible Work?

Flexible work refers to any work arrangement that deviates from the traditional 9-to-5, in-office work model. It encompasses various forms, including:

1. Remote Work: Employees have the option to work from a location of their choice, often from home or a co-working space, using digital tools to collaborate with colleagues.

2. Flexible Hours: Employees can adjust their daily or weekly work hours within certain limits, providing greater control over their schedules.

3. Compressed Workweeks: Employees complete their standard weekly hours in fewer days, allowing for longer weekends.

4. Job Sharing: Two or more employees share the responsibilities and workload of a single full-time position.

5. Part-Time Work: Employees work fewer hours than full-time positions, typically with a pro-rated salary and benefits.

The Advantages of Flexible Work

1. Work-Life Balance: Flexible work arrangements empower individuals to better balance their professional and personal lives, reducing stress and improving overall well-being.

2. Increased Productivity: Many employees report higher levels of productivity when working in a flexible environment, as they can choose the times when they’re most productive.

3. Cost Savings: Employees can save on commuting costs and other work-related expenses, while employers can reduce overhead costs associated with office space.

4. Attracting and Retaining Talent: Offering flexible work options can make a company more attractive to a diverse talent pool and improve employee retention.

5. Accommodating Life Changes: Flexible work arrangements allow employees to accommodate life changes, such as caring for children, pursuing higher education, or managing health conditions.

Benefits for Employers

1. Increased Employee Loyalty: Companies that offer flexible work often experience higher employee loyalty and lower turnover rates.

2. Access to a Wider Talent Pool: Flexible work arrangements can attract talent from different geographic locations and backgrounds.

3. Enhanced Productivity: Employees who can work when and where they are most productive often deliver better results.

4. Cost Savings: Reduced office space requirements and overhead costs can result in significant savings for employers.

5. Business Continuity: Flexible work models can help companies maintain operations during unexpected events, such as natural disasters or public health crises.

Implementing Flexible Work Successfully

For flexible work arrangements to be successful, it’s essential to:

  1. Set Clear Expectations: Establish clear guidelines for performance, communication, and availability to ensure everyone is on the same page.

  2. Leverage Technology: Invest in digital tools and platforms that facilitate remote work, collaboration, and communication.

  3. Offer Training: Provide training to employees and managers on how to effectively manage and participate in flexible work arrangements.

  4. Regularly Review and Adapt: Continuously assess and adapt your flexible work policies and practices based on feedback and evolving needs.
